Abstract

This paper generalizes a classical result about the space of bounded closed sets with the Hausdorff metric, and establishes the completeness of CB ( X ) with respect to the completeness of the metric space X, where CB ( X ) is the class of fuzzy sets with nonempty bounded closed α -cut sets, equipped with the supremum metric d ∞ which takes the supremum on the Hausdorff distances between the corresponding α -cut sets. In addition, some common fixed point theorems for fuzzy mappings are proved and two examples are given to illustrate the validity of the main results in fixed point theory.
